Story

Mud, Sweat and Fears

Umber Creative's super team of staff, friends and family are taking part in the Royal British Legion Major Series - a muddy 10-12km run through a military obstacle course - crossing rivers, crawling through mud and climbing cargo nets under the watchful eye of Drill Sergeants from the British military.

Why on earth would we want to do this?

We want to raise funds for the wonderful Hull based charity the HEY Smile Foundation. A charity that has helped countless people, charities and projects in our local region. Including; Children with disabilities, Inshore Rescue, Down Syndrome, Memory Loss, Nursing and Respite Care as well as many others. www.heysmilefoundation.org

Who is running?

The 10 brave runners who have volunteered are: Kara, Kevin, Luke, Anna, Am, Tom, Roxanne, Neil, Amy & Joanne. More runners may join the team as we get closer to the event.
